Overview:

BPC-157 is a synthetic peptide composed of 15 amino acids, which is why it is classified as a pentadecapeptide. It is modeled after a peptide sequence associated with proteins found in gastric tissue and has been studied in laboratory and preclinical settings for its potential role in cellular signaling and tissue-response pathways.

Much of the scientific interest around BPC-157 comes from its interaction with biological processes involved in structural remodeling, vascular response, nitric oxide signaling, and angiogenesis-related pathways. 

BPC-157 has been studied in experimental models involving gastrointestinal tissue, connective tissue, vascular response, inflammatory signaling, and cellular repair pathways.

Mechanism Overview: 

BPC-157 has been investigated for potential interactions with several biological pathways, including nitric oxide signaling, VEGF-related angiogenesis, endothelial function, fibroblast activity, and extracellular matrix remodeling. These mechanisms remain investigational and are primarily based on preclinical research.

Structure:

Sequence: Gly-Glu-Pro-Pro-Pro-Gly-Lys-Pro-Ala-Asp-Asp-Ala-Gly-Leu-Val

CAS: 1628202-19-6

Molecular Weight: ~1419.5 g/mol
